Non-contact linear sensors have an 
analog output that is proportional to 
the damping target distance. Their 
compact yet sturdy design makes 
them suitable for industrial, robotics, 
and laboratory use.
These sensors use inductive 
technology, which means they can 
sense any metal target. The sensing 
distance, however, is influenced 
by the metal target. Ranges are 
calibrated using a standard square 
target. The target is mild steel 
(Fe 360), 1 mm (0.04") thick. 
The side lengths are the larger of 
either the sensor’s face diaphragm 
or 3 times the sensing distance.

Sensing distances are influenced by 
metals other than mild steel. The 
“Correction Factors” chart, shown 
below, shows the reduction that 
occurs when brass or other target 
metals are used. For example, if the 
target were brass, the LD701-1/2 
would sense 0.5 to 1 mm 
(0.02 to 0.04").
The voltage output generated is 
directly linear to the distance being 
measured. The output can be read 
by panel meters, recorders, computer 
boards, or data loggers, all of which 
are available from OMEGA®.

CORRECTION FACTORS 
MATERIAL APPROX.
Mild steel 1.0 
Stainless steel 0.75 
Brass 0.50 
Aluminum 0.40 
Copper 0.35
